GNU/Linux >> LINUX-Kenntnisse >  >> Linux

GitBash fordert MFA in AWS CLI nicht an

Ein kurzer Beitrag zur Behebung eines Problems mit Gitbash, das MFA-Eingabeaufforderungen bei der Verwendung von AWS CLI verhindert.

Problem

GitBash unter der Haube verwendet den Winpty-Emulator, um ein Bash-Erlebnis unter Windows bereitzustellen. Winpty funktioniert nicht gut mit AWS CLI, insbesondere beim Umgang mit MFA-Eingabeaufforderungen. Daher müssen Sie dies durch bash.exe ersetzen und Sie sollten gut sein.

Verfahren

Gehen Sie zum Windows-Startmenü und suchen Sie nach Git Bash. Klicken Sie auf Speicherort öffnen.

Klicken Sie mit der rechten Maustaste auf die Verknüpfung und wählen Sie Eigenschaften

Ändern Sie unter Eigenschaften das Ziel von „C:\Program Files\Git\git-bash.exe “ nach „C:\Programme\Git\bin\bash.exe

Starten Sie jetzt GitBash und Sie sollten gut sein.


Linux
  1. Verwenden von Bash für die Automatisierung

  2. Auf Prozess prüfen, wenn dieser läuft?

  3. Verwenden Sie die Erweiterung .sh oder .bash für Bash-Skripte?

  4. Leerzeichen für Variablen in Bash-Skript?

  5. So installieren Sie awscli

Bash für Schleife

Bash-Scripting-Tutorial für Anfänger

Bash Heredoc-Tutorial für Anfänger

Slack für die CLI – Slack

Array in Bash nicht gefunden

bash sh - Befehl nicht gefunden